Output d59cbaea7ba80bb9e5e8602ece3897362b47a8d41bcbc917420619a29d53f40f:16

value
18632896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b681432a217995063b9fcf38c51c2949bbfa1098 OP_EQUAL
address
MQYA4ediZ9KaP3yVyTW3t1NsyhDdU5zUXN
transaction
d59cbaea7ba80bb9e5e8602ece3897362b47a8d41bcbc917420619a29d53f40f
spent
true